Onwards & Upwards

I can't actually pinpoint when I began running regularly. I know it was about October 2014 aged 47 but I didn't start using a running app until January 2015 and so I'll say about 12 months.
Neither can I say exactly how many miles or runs I've made as I've now used 3 apps and on occasion none at all. I do know that I've run roughly 3 times per week and my distance has increased to approximately 18k per week.
This year I intend to keep better track of when I run and how far as well as blogging where possible, particularly if I enter any races. Last year I entered 3, Race for Life 5K, UKTriathlon 10K and MoRun 10K - the latter of which I got the date wrong and missed so was gutted.
I'm beginning to look at possible races to enter and would like to increase my distance to include at least one half marathon. I'm determined not to enter anything I can't compete in fully though so have a way to go yet.
I haven't started the New Year making running resolutions rather than aiming for better including longer distance and more personal best's. So I will begin by listing where I'm at right now;

Fastest 1K         04.47
Fastest 1Mile    08.10
Fastest 5K         26.32
Fastest 10K       53.51
Farthest Run       6.8 mile

Another intention is to train more thoroughly which includes looking at what I eat and which additional fitness regimes I can put in - hill running being on that list.
So as I begin my second year as a runner - as I reckon I can call myself that now, I still have a long road and a steep hill ahead of me...
